The pdb file is generated by the /Zi flag. Add that to the list of
flags in your release build.

I built GDAL in both Debug and Release.
The default behavior is to create .pdb files in Debug, but
not in Release.
I would like to get a pdb file in Release build as well, is
it possible ?
The only lines I see that have to do with pdb, are:
!IFNDEF DEBUG
OPTFLAGS= $(CXX_ANALYZE_FLAGS) /nologo /MT /EHsc /Ox
/D_CRT_SECURE_NO_DEPRECATE /D_CRT_NONSTDC_NO_DEPRECATE
/DNDEBUG /Fd$(LIBDIR)\gdal$(VERSION).pdb
/ITERATOR_DEBUG_LEVEL=0
!ELSE
OPTFLAGS= $(CXX_ANALYZE_FLAGS) /nologo /MTd /EHsc /Zi
/D_CRT_SECURE_NO_DEPRECATE /D_CRT_NONSTDC_NO_DEPRECATE
/Fd$(LIBDIR)\gdal$(VERSION).pdb /DDEBUG
/ITERATOR_DEBUG_LEVEL=2
!ENDIF
It is not apparent to me how to get pdb files to be created,
based on this.
